Data management techniques: final version (opens in new window)

This deliverable summarizes the work done in T3.1, T3.2, and T3.3 at the end of the tasks. It contains the updated and consolidated definition of policies related to data layout, communication, and security. Furthermore, it reports the architectural details and the characteristics of all the components implemented in the different tasks.
